Get notified when packages are built

A new feature has been added. FreshPorts already tracks package built by the FreeBSD project. This information is displayed on each port page. You can now get an email when FreshPorts notices a new package is available for something on one of your watch lists. However, you must opt into that. Click on Report Subscriptions on the right, and New Package Notification box, and click on Update.

Finally, under Watch Lists, click on ABI Package Subscriptions to select your ABI (e.g. FreeBSD:14:amd64) & package set (latest/quarterly) combination for a given watch list. This is what FreshPorts will look for.

Thursday, 6 Apr 2006
06:29 mi search for other commits by this committer
Do not run-depend on festival -- it really ought to be the other way
around.

For festlex-cmu use the 2004 version found in the 1.95 directory, so that
it works with audio/festival. The others did not change since 1999.

Stop the silly practice of extracting into ${WRKDIR} and copying into
destination -- extract directly.

Replace @dirrm with @dirrmtry in a few places and unbreak by adding more
of same.

The same should be applied to other audio/fest* ports, but these are
enough to get the English-only speech out of festival.
